Coriander Spot Prices Softens in Gujarat Amid Expected Imports

Ahmedabad, July 03 (CommoditiesControl): Coriander prices in Gujarat experienced a softening trend today, with a decline of Rs 10 per 20 kg. Market analysts attribute this dip to a combination of factors, including reduced arrivals and subdued demand.

The recent rains have significantly curtailed coriander arrivals, and the current demand is relatively low. Traders are also discussing the potential impact of Russian coriander entering the Indian market within the next one or two months. This speculation is contributing to the current softness in the coriander market. The market trends are now closely tied to the anticipated demand for coriander during the upcoming festival season.

Today, Saurashtra saw an arrival of approximately 6000 bags of coriander. The average price in the state ranges from Rs 1300 to Rs 1500 per 20 kg.

In Gondal Mandi, a total of 4408 bags (equivalent to 40kg per bag) were traded, including 4200 bags of new arrivals and pending bags. Prices in Gondal Mandi ranged from Rs 1361 to Rs 1681 per 20 kg. Meanwhile, Rajkot Mandi recorded the trade of 600 bags of coriander, with prices ranging from Rs 1200 to Rs 1420 per 20 kg.

Jamjodhpur Mandi was closed today due to rain. In Junagadh Mandi, 250 bags were received, and Jetpur Mandi saw the arrival of 50 bags. Additionally, around 1000 bags arrived from nearby areas.

Dhaniya contract for JUL delivery settled at Rs 7246/quintal showing an rise of Rs 42 over previous close of Rs 7204/quintal,The contract moved in the range of Rs 7190-7280 for the day. Open interest decreased by -535 MT to 19525 MT, while trading volume decreased by -1375 to 1740 MT.

Dhaniya contract for AUG delivery settled at Rs 7332/quintal showing an rise of Rs 24 over previous close of Rs 7308/quintal,The contract moved in the range of Rs 7304-7374 for the day. Open interest increased by 710 MT to 12930 MT, while trading volume decreased by -750 to 1735 MT.

Currently The spread between JUL and AUG contract is -86 Rs/quintal.

Dhaniya stock in NCDEX accredited warehouse as on 03-Jul-2024, was 15452 MT
